In anticipation of a record sixth year, Texas Arena League announces dates and locations

  • Jan 27-29 Brookshire Polo Club, Brookshire, TX
  • Feb 10-12 Dripping Springs Ranch Park Dripping Springs, TX
  • Feb 24-26 Legends Polo Club, Kaufman, TX
  • March 10-12 Legends Polo Club, Kaufman, TX

In addition to the regular host clubs – Legends Polo Club and Brookshire Polo Club – in 2023, a new location has been secured. Dripping Springs Ranch Park Event Center & Arena located just West of Austin.

Dripping Springs Ranch Park

A 130-acre facility complete with covered arena, stalls, RV, bleachers, and everything else needed for our event. “We are very excited to add Ranch Park Dripping Springs to the calendar for TAL in 2023,” says TAL committee member Karl Hilberg. “With over 120 players and 280 horses competing in 2022, we needed to find a location close to some of the participants with a covered arena and plenty of stabling. With some temporary build-out to make the arena suitable for polo and lots of room for spectators, Ranch Park looks will fit the bill.”

For 2023, TAL will continue with the 4 flights as it did in 2022. The flights are 6-9 goal and C Flight on Fridays, 0-3 goal on Saturdays, and 3-6 goal on Sundays.

With four events currently on the calendar and a limit on the number of teams that can play within each day, TAL will create additional opportunities to accommodate the expected number of teams. For 2023, TAL is anticipating adding the Armadillo Division to Texas Arena League. This will be two more weekends of arena polo, TAL points, prizes and parties – February 4-5 and March 4-5.

“There are so many players and teams showing interest in playing 2023 Texas Arena League that we had to find a way to accommodate as many as we can. That’s why we have decided to add the Armadillo Division to Texas Arena League,” says Nacho Estrada, owner of Legends Polo Club and TAL committee member. “The league is so much fun and everyone enjoys the camaraderie. Plus, it is competitive at every level. That is what makes Texas Arena League attractive.”
